Voya Financial has promoted Heather Lavallee to president of its employee benefits business. Previously, Lavallee was head of distribution for employee benefits, and also a former western regional vice president and general manager.

In this newly created role, Lavallee is responsible for all aspects of the group and voluntary insurance business, including strategy, product management, underwriting, actuarial and distribution. Before joining the company in 2008, Lavallee held senior sales and marketing management roles for other large group life, disability and stop-loss insurance providers.

Voya Financial is the new name of recently rebranded ING U.S. Its employee benefits business provides stop-loss, group life and disability income insurance products to midsize and large employers and their employees.
